Thursday, October 8, the kindergarten classes at Canyon Crest Elementary School
had a special visit from their future high school principal. It was Principal Terry Abernathy's way of reminding the students that they
may be just kindergartners now, but they are future graduates of the Kaiser High
School Class of 2022.
"We're a vertical team," explained Mr. Abernathy. "I don't want Kaiser High
School to be a mystery to them. All Future Cats will know what it means to be a
successful Kaiser High student on their way to college! My goal is to
build Cat Pride and school spirit for all students in my feeder path. ALL
Kaiser students will be successful!"
Along with Mr. Abernathy were Assistant Principal Richard Valencia and ASB
Advisor Glennon Poirier, as well as Kaiser High School seniors Anthony Brown,
Andriuss Myles, Alyssia Palomino, Dante Chapman, Stephanie Curiel, Tyler
Holbrook, and the Kaiser Cat mascot. Mr. Abernathy
handpicked these students to accompany him when he visited the
kindergarteners because they are all college-bound upon graduation, many of them
with athletic or academic scholarships.
As he reminded the kindergarteners, "Right now you are
Canyon Crest Coyotes, then you will be Southridge Middle School Knights, and
then you will be Kaiser High School Cats - and what comes after that?"
"College!" they loudly responded. "That's right!" said Mr.
Abernathy, "Parents, start saving for college now!"
With the help of the Kaiser students, Mr. Abernathy and Mr. Valencia demonstrated the official Kaiser Cat hand sign for the little guys
and showed them how after they graduate and go to college, the Kaiser Cat
becomes a Mega Cat - Grrrrrrr!
Mr. Abernathy has visited the kindergarten classes at each of Kaiser's feeder
elementary schools: Canyon Crest, Chaparral, Oak Park, and Shadow Hills. Each kindergartner was given a "Future Kaiser Cat" T-shirt with
"Class of 2022" on the back which was purchased for them by Kaiser's
ASB. They will also be invited to attend
future Kaiser events, including a varsity football game.
